Registration and Insurance Requirements for Electric Scooters
In the state of Connecticut mopeds are required to be registered and follow normal traffic rules. They must use the right lane or shoulder (unless turning left) and can only carry one person.
Mopeds must also have a motor that is smaller than 50cc, and produce less than two horsepower for brakes. If your scooter exceeds the requirements above it will be considered a motorcycle. It is subject to different rules.

Pennsylvania
In Pennsylvania electric scooters are classified as motor vehicles. The state requires drivers to register their scooters and to maintain insurance. They must also show proof of ownership, which is done by presenting the manufacturer's certificate of origin or a bill of sale. The cost for registration varies depending on county. Additionally, all scooters must be inspected by the Pennsylvania Department of Environmental Protection. The cost for inspection is 15 dollars.
State law defines a moped as one that is equipped with pedals, a motor that has 50 cc of displacement and less, and produces not more than 2 brake horsepower. A moped should also be able to travel at 30 MPH over an unpaved surface. Mopeds should be used by anyone who is 16 years or older.
A moped must be registered and titled at the sum of $9 in order to be allowed to use public roads. Furthermore, a driver of a moped must have a Class C license as well as have insurance. Moped accidents still happen despite these regulations. These accidents can result in serious injuries, like traumatizing head injuries, spinal cord injury or even death.
To get a moped driver's license, you must pass a test of knowledge at your local PennDOT Driver License Center. The test will test your knowledge of the laws regarding motorcycles as well as safety guidelines and road signs. If you pass the test, you can then take a motorcycle skill test. You'll need your motorcycle learner permit, an ID with a valid photo and cash to pay the licensing fee. Once you've completed the motorcycle skills exam, you can upgrade your license to Class M.

New Mexico
In New Mexico, motor scooters are legally classified as motorcycles or mopeds. In the state of New Mexico, the definition of a motorcycle is any two-wheeled vehicle with an engine that is greater than 50cc, and is subject to registration and insurance. Mopeds are two-wheeled vehicles with pedals that have a motor no larger than 50cc, and that produce 2 brake horsepower. In general, mopeds do not require registration or titling, however the state recommends that they have liability insurance. Helmets are required for all mopeds and motorized bikes and motorized bicycles.
Anyone who wants a license to drive a moped has to pass a written test at the local MVD. The test covers the rules of the road and safety requirements for the moped. The test also covers questions on how to operate a motorbike, and what to do in the event that you are involved in an accident. In addition to the test, applicants must submit evidence of identity and pass an eye exam. The test is usually given at the time a person applies for a New Mexico ID card or driver's license.
People who are applying for their first license in the state, or already have a license from another state, must pass an optical test. Those who fail the eye test must wait for a year before trying again. In addition, those who are 16 or older and want to drive a scooter pass a driving skill test to obtain their license.
